====== KeePass2 ======
{{:keepass2:keepass_icon.png?150|}}
Программа для хранения паролей.
:!: Для работы требуется ''.NET Framework'' или ''Mono''
https://keepass.info
Подобные программы:
* [[keepassx:keepassx|]]
* [[keepassxc:keepassxc|]]
====== Установка ======
apt install keepass2
====== Настройка ======
Файл настройки:
|Общий|''/usr/lib/keepass2/KeePass.exe.config''|
|Пользователя|''~.config/KeePass/KeePass.config.xml''|
===== Локализация =====
- Находим нужный перевод на этой странице: [[https://keepass.info/translations.html|Translations - KeePass]]
- Распаковываем архив
- Содержимое архива копируем в папку: \\ ''/usr/lib/keepass2/Languages''
====== Замена ссылок по схемам ======
В меню ''Настройка'', вкладка ''Интеграция'' кнопка ''Замена ссылок по схемам''
Также можно внести параметры в файл ''KeePass.config.xml''.
Пример для [[debian:debian|]]:
0
true
ssh
cmd:// evilvte -fn "monospace 12" -T {TITLE} -e sshpass -p '{PASSWORD}' ssh -l {USERNAME} {TITLE}
true
sftp
cmd:// filezilla sftp://{USERNAME}:{PASSWORD}@{TITLE}
true
ftp
cmd:// filezilla ftp://{USERNAME}:{PASSWORD}@{TITLE}
true
Radmin
cmd://wine /opt/Admin/Radmin/Radmin.exe /connect:{TITLE}:4899 /8bpp
true
ldap
cmd://wine /opt/Admin/LdapAdmin/LdapAdmin.exe "ldap://{USERNAME}:{PASSWORD}@{TITLE}"
Пример для [[ms_windows:ms_windows|]]:
0
true
ssh_old
cmd://C:\Admin\KiTTY.cmd -load "{TITLE}" -l {USERNAME} -pw {PASSWORD}
true
http
cmd://C:\Programs\FireFox\firefox.exe "{URL}"
true
https
cmd://C:\Programs\FireFox\firefox.exe "{URL}"
true
sftp
cmd://C:\Admin\FileZilla.cmd sftp://{USERNAME}:{PASSWORD}@{TITLE}
true
RAdmin
cmd://C:\Admin\Radmin\Radmin.exe /connect:{TITLE}:4899 /8bpp
true
vnc
cmd://C:\Admin\VNCviewer.cmd {TITLE} {USERNAME} {PASSWORD}
true
ldap
cmd://C:\Admin\LdapAdmin\LdapAdmin.exe ldap://{USERNAME}:{PASSWORD}@{TITLE}
true
ftp
cmd://C:\Admin\FileZilla.cmd ftp://{USERNAME}:{PASSWORD}@{TITLE}
true
ssh
cmd://C:\Admin\KiTTY.cmd -ssh {USERNAME}@{TITLE} -title {TITLE} -pw {PASSWORD}
====== KeeFox ======
FIXME
- Установка расширения \\ https://addons.mozilla.org/ru/firefox/addon/keefox/
- Скопировать
~/.mozilla/firefox/hm9mzdk1.default/extensions/keefox@chris.tomlinson/deps/KeePassRPC.plgx
в
/usr/lib/keepass2/plugins
- Установка необходимых пакетов
add-apt-repository ppa:dlech/keepass2-plugins
Нужно исправит файл:
deb http://ppa.launchpad.net/dlech/keepass2-plugins/ubuntu devel main
apt-get update
apt-get install xul-ext-keefox
- Перезапустить браузер
**Список пакетов**:
apt install keepass2-plugin-rpc libmono-system-configuration-install4.0-cil libmono-system-management4.0-cil
====== Решение проблем ======
===== Проблема с переключением между файлами =====
**Описание**
Если открыть в программе насколько файлов то их названия будут отображены как имена вкладок. При попытке выбрать нужную вкладку возникает ошибка и программа завершается.
Ошибка выявлена в [[debian:debian|Debian]] 7, 8 при работе в [[icewm:icewm|IceWM]].
**Решение**
В меню ''Настройка'', вкладка ''Дополнительно'' раздел ''Дополнительно'' отметить пункт: ''Принудительно использовать системный шрифт (только для Unix)''
Тоже самое можно сделать если в файле ''KeePass.config.xml'' удалить параметр:
false
====== Собственные команды запуска ======
FIXME
cmd://sakura -t {TITLE} -e sshpass -p {PASSWORD} ssh -l {USERNAME} {TITLE} -o StrictHostKeyChecking=no
https://github.com/kvaps/keepass-url-overrides
====== Ссылки ======
[[https://upload.wikimedia.org/wikipedia/commons/1/19/KeePass_icon.png|Логотип]]
[[https://github.com/luckyrat/KeeFox/issues/172|Provide an Ubuntu package]]
http://planet.ubuntuusers.de/27/?keepThis=true
[[https://apps.apple.com/us/app/minikeepass/id451661808|MiniKeePass (iOS)]]
{{tag>Debian Linux MS_Windows Password}}